Story Summary

Project Silence is set in a fictional post-world war city of Black Water. The city is rife with corruption, crime, and political intrigue. Our main protagonist is a former soldier who came back to the city to find it being run by ruthless mobsters and corrupt officials. We find out the character's motivations over the course of the game as they navigate the crime-ridden streets, recruiting allies, and taking down enemies.

Players will explore various locations within the city, each with its own unique atmosphere and challenges. The story is driven by the player's choices and actions, which will determine the outcome of the game.

Tone and Themes

The tone of Project Silence is dark and gritty, with a focus on stealth, action, and questionable moral choices. The game explores themes of corruption, power, and redemption, as the player navigates the dangerous world of Black Water. The visuals and sound design of the game will reflect this tone, with a dark and moody atmosphere that immerses the player in film noir-inspired setting.

Back Story

Our story begins with own of our protagonists, a young man, down on his luck and desperate for a way to 'make ends meet' in the city and help out his family. He finds his way to a local bar where a shady man gives him various jobs to do. These jobs range from simple thefts to more complex heists. The young man proves himself to be a skilled intelligence gatherer and master of disguise, and is soon recruited into a group of professional thieves who operate in the city. Their motivations are unclear at first, but as the story unfolds, we learn more about their pasts and their reasons for doing what they do.

Plot Outline

Act 1: Setup

The young man, named Bobby (a.k.a. The Kid), is recruited into a group of professional thieves who operate in the city. His role in the group is to scout out locations, gather intel, and report back to the team. As he completes various jobs, he begins to gain the trust of his fellow thieves. We find out that his sister is unable to work due to illness and he is the sole provider for his family.

Act 2: Confrontation

As the team completes more heists, they begin to attract the attention of the local crime boss, and the threat to his operations they pose. The team must navigate more and more dangerous situations as they try to stay one step ahead of the mobsters.

It isn't until later in the story that we find out the truth about Bobby and his loyalty to the team. Bobby returns to his sister to find mobsters in his home, at first it looks like they've found him, but then we find out that Bobby was approached earlier by Don Mangione and forced to report the teams movements. The Don was using the young man and the team to take out his rivals in the criminal underworld, but now the team has outlived their usefulness and the Don wants them all dead.

Bobby's sister finds out about his betrayal and pleads with him to help save the teams lives. Despite his betrayal, Bobby decides to help the team and his sister escape the city.

Act 3: Resolution

Bobby and the team prepare for their final heist, to steal the ledger from the Don's mansion. Bobby's role, given to him by the Don, is to disable the security systems and let the team in and allow them to steal the ledger. The team successfully steals the ledger and makes their escape. Everything looks like it's going to plan for the team, but as they make their final delivery to the client, the safe house is raided by the mobsters. Part of the team is captured, but the crew has a few more tricks up their sleeves.
